Abstract

The utility model relates to a multiple magazine type self-guarding pistol, comprising an emission magazine and a pistol body provided with an electric igniter. The emission magazine and the pistol body are combined, wherein, the emission magazine contains many emission tubes; shots, emission gunpowder, and an ignition electric bridge are arranged in each emission tube. The electric igniter comprises a driver plate switch, an inching-trigger switch, a power source battery, etc. Switches are controlled by a trigger. So, when the trigger is triggered, two ends of the ignition electric bridge are ignited by the effect of the power source voltage to two ends of the ignition electric bridge, which ignites ambient emission gunpowder and shoots out the shot along the emission tube. The multiple magazine type self-guarding pistol can have manifold functions synchronously and expediently such as killing function, harming function, tear promoting function, signal function, etc. by replacing the magazine filled with different kinds of shots such as steel ball shots, rubber shots, tear promoting shots, alarm signal shots, etc.

Multiple magazine type self-guarding pistol
The utility model relates to a kind of hand-held small arms.A kind of in particular magazine formula pistol.
Service pistol generally is made up of parts such as gun barrel, rifle body, hammer, trigger and magazines.Gun barrel short recoil automatic principle is adopted in the emission of bullet usually, for example homemade 54 formulas, 80 formula pistols; Perhaps adopt the blowback automatic principle, for example homemade 59 formulas, 84 formula pistols.Though the service pistol development is so far, performance has all improved many in every respect,, they are still keeping bullet, rifle to separate supporting citation form, so the use of pistol is single, also is that it can not launch dissimilar bullets.In addition, though the effective range of pistol generally can reach tens meters to more than 100 meters at present,, in some occasion, this has but limited its application on the contrary, for example under the many occasions of people, hurts innocent persons easily; When handling the public security criminal scene of not wishing target is deadly or serious permanent disability, then often be difficult to guarantee.In fact, a kind of pistol is not arranged as yet at present, it can launch dissimilar bullets according to different needs.
The purpose of this utility model is: design a kind of magazine formula pistol, its rifle body is the split convolution with the emission magazine, when the magazine of dissimilar bullets is equipped with in replacing, can launch dissimilar bullets, kill and wound, cause injury thereby have concurrently, break tear, functions such as signal.
The technical solution of the utility model is as follows: magazine formula pistol comprises upper and lower rifle body, trigger, and it also comprises the electric igniter of the propellant that ignites especially, and the emission magazine that can separate with the rifle body, wherein, the emission magazine comprises the magazine body, transmitting tube, propellant, igniting electric bridge, bullet, boosting piston, transmitting tube closing cock and electric bridge conductive plug, electric igniter is then by power-supply battery, dial switch, the fine motion trigger switch, the igniting electrically conductive socket is formed.Cocking, supply voltage act on igniting electric bridge two ends, make it to ignite, thereby and light propellant, bullet is penetrated along transmitting tube.
The utlity model has following advantage: 1. can separate with the rifle body in view of the emission magazine, therefore, can change the magazine that the variety classes bullet is housed, for example bomb with steel balls easily, the rubber bullet break tear bullet etc., thereby making it to have concurrently kills and wounds, cause injury, break tear, functions such as signal;
2. magazine is actual to comprise a plurality of transmitting tubes owing to launching, so realize many bullets pilosity easily;
3. the gunpowder because the employing electric ignition is ignited is not only lighted a fire reliably, and is made the simple in structure of rifle, weight saving.

As can be seen from Figure 2, present embodiment is a special multitube emission magazine 2 that can separate and the electric igniter of the propellant that ignites with the rifle body.Multitube emission magazine 2 is by magazine body 33, transmitting tube 34, propellant 35, igniting electric bridge 5, bullet 3, boosting piston 4, transmitting tube closing cock 1, electric bridge plug 8 is formed, and magazine body 33 is shaped on the multitube transmitting tube, propellant 35 is housed, igniting electric bridge 5, bullet 3 in each transmitting tube, boosting piston 4, transmitting tube closing cock 1, electric bridge plug 8, whole magazine body 33 are installed in the muzzle position of upper cutting gun 18 by dead lock 30 lockings of trigger guard shape.Supply voltage is introduced by electric bridge conductive plug 8, and acts on igniting electric bridge 5 two ends, can light its propellant 35 all around after it ignites.Consequent thrust promotes bullet 3 along transmitting tube 34 outgoing via boosting piston 4.Obviously, as long as adopt different bullets 3, bomb with steel balls for example, the rubber bullet, the glass marble bullet, the alarm signal bullet breaks tear bullet etc., can make it to have concurrently to kill and wound, and causes injury, and breaks different functions such as tear or signal.For the bullet 3 of same type, its range and effectiveness then depend on the length of transmitting tube 34, the factors such as amount of propellant 35.For reaching the purpose that is enough to defend.Its effective range should be not less than 8 meters.Generally, the length of transmitting tube 34 is the 70--80 millimeter, and its bore is advisable for 5 millimeters with φ, also can be slightly larger.Therefore, the ellipse garden shape emission magazine 2 for 30 * 20 millimeters is enough to hold 3 to 10 transmitting tubes 34.Launch magazine 2 as long as this explanation is packed into one, can pull the trigger as many as continuously 10 times.In addition,, a magazine locking arc positioning groove 32 is arranged respectively in emission magazine 2 two bottom sides, so as emission magazine 2 behind the upper cutting gun 18 of packing into it locking fix.
Electric igniter shown in the present embodiment comprises power-supply battery 23, dial switch 15, and fine motion trigger switch 14, igniting electrically conductive socket 36, and harness 17 and the positive negative conductor 26 of power supply of realizing its electrical connection, and above each parts are formed by connecting.Referring to Fig. 1, power-supply battery 23 is placed in the slotted eye of lower gun body 25 handle inside, and dial switch 15 and fine motion trigger switch 14 are installed in the afterbody and the medium position of upper cutting gun 18 respectively, and corresponding with trigger pressing plate 13, igniting electrically conductive socket 36 is installed in electric bridge conductive plug 8 corresponding positions.As can be seen from Figure 3, igniting electrically conductive socket 36 comprises electrically conductive socket body 7, electrically conductive socket conductive contact 9, conduction spring 10 and socket welding rivet 12.Its purpose is that when emission magazine 2 was packed upper cutting gun 18 into, can match to merge with electric bridge conductive plug 8 keeps good electrical contact.What obviously, the number of electrically conductive socket conductive contact 9 wherein and position must be with electric bridge conductive plugs 8 is corresponding to the same; In addition, electrically conductive socket body 7 must constitute with insulating materials, for example plastics or bakelite, because in the present embodiment, the rifle body is by metal material as the public negative terminal of power supply, and for example steel constitutes.In addition, in order to realize the continuous percussion of multitube, need in turn supply voltage to be added on continuously the igniting electric bridge 5 of each transmitting tube 34 the inside in the emission magazine 2.Adopt dial switch 15 to realize this purpose in the present embodiment.Because dial switch is a kind of switch with a plurality of connection contacts, and every switch once, its connection contact will skip to its following one automatically.So,, just can control the continuous percussion of 10 transmitting tubes 34 of as many as easily when employing has 10 dial switch 15 that are communicated with contact.In view of dial switch 15 just is used for the some concrete transmitting tubes 34 of gating, so also need adopt a fine motion trigger switch 14 that is connected in series with it to control actual igniting emission.The actual switch action of these two switches is to be realized with pressing by the pine of trigger 27, and for this reason, the trigger 27 of present embodiment pistol also with a trigger pressing plate 13, when it is depressed, opens dial switch 15 and fine motion trigger switch 14; When pine is pressed, switch is turned off.In the present embodiment, supply voltage is 3 volts, is in series by 1.5 volts of batteries 23 of two joints, and this voltage is enough to ignite, and to open ignition voltage be 1.5 volts igniting electric bridge 5.
The locking of emission magazine 2 and rifle body in the present embodiment, is realized by dead lock 30.Referring to Fig. 4, the profile of dead lock 30 is the trigger guard that is similar to common pistol, and still, its top is the garden arc, and there is dead lock pivot pin 31 centre.The actual curvature of garden arc is as the criterion to match with the magazine locking arc positioning groove 32 of launching magazine 2 outsides.Like this, when dead lock 30 when its pivot pin 32 rotates, its arc top, garden can screw in or screw out magazine locking arc positioning groove 32, corresponds respectively to launch magazine 2 and the rifle body is in the state that locks or take off lock.
From Fig. 1 also as can be known, in order to make igniting electrically conductive socket 36 location, be provided with electrically conductive socket alignment pin 6 at the corresponding site of upper cutting gun 18; In like manner,, be provided with the locking locator that dead lock location pellet shot from a slingshot 29 and dead lock location marble pressuring spring 28 are formed at the corresponding site of lower gun body 25, and trigger back-moving spring alignment pin 21, use respectively so that the location of dead lock 30 and trigger back-moving spring 20.
